Is Dark Chocolate Chips profitable on Amazon?

According to Flapen's Amazon United Kingdom niche tracking, Dark Chocolate Chips is a £177K/yr Amazon United Kingdom market (124K searches/yr). The top 5 brands hold 56% of demand. Demand peaks in Feb–Mar. Verdict: Worth a look — 57/100.
